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os was extensively used as an building material from the 1930s until the 1970s. It was put in insulation for pipes, fireproofing materials, cements and plasters, automobile brakes and many more. The exposure to this dangerous mineral can trigger a number of serious medical conditions, including mesothelioma as well as other respiratory illnesses.

When asbestos is mined and processed, the tiny fibers separate easily and can be breathed in. This could lead to asbestosis, lung cancer, and mesothelioma. Workers who are exposed to the mineral face an increased risk of exposure than other workers however, even those who do not deal with it directly may breathe it in. This kind of exposure is called secondary exposure, and it can affect anyone who is around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es relatives who wash the uniform of the worker, as well as any other person living in the same house. This could happen on military bases and ships where the workers wear the identical uniform for a long time.

Asbestos can be a problem for those who work in shipyards, construction and mills, as well as mining, insulation and other industries. This was particularly true in the United States between the 1950s and 1990s. Workers could be exposed to asbestos when older buildings were demolished or remodeled as well as when construction materials were damaged. Even the demolition or renovation of older buildings can release asbestos in the air.

It could take some period of time between exposure to asbestos before the onset of mesothelioma, or other symptoms. It is therefore essential to see a doctor when you've been exposed to asbestos or think you might be suffering from any of the illnesses associated with it.

Your doctor will check your lungs, and ask about any asbestos-related work experience.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related disease they'll likely refer you to a specialist to get more tests. Chest X-rays, CT scans and pulmonary function tests are all able to detect asbestos-related diseases but they do not always appear on these tests.

These illnesses can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Asbestos is a fibrous substance used in many industrial applications due to its resistance to heat as well as its flexibility and strength. Unfortunately, asbestos also causes numerous serious health conditions, including mesothelioma and lung cancer. These diseases can be painful, debilitating and sometimes f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os may be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it can cover medical bills, lost wages, home expenses for health care, and more.

Workers who have come into contact with asbestos must immediately report any symptoms of illness. This is especially important for construction workers, who are frequently exposed to asbestos when renovating old buildings. These buildings were built before asbestos was recognized as a carcinogen that could cause harm, and they may contain unsafe levels of asbestos.

Exposure to asbestos can trigger numerous ailments, and the signs of these ailments typically do not appear for 25 to 50 years after the exposure. People who have been exposed to asbestos should visit their doctor regularly for health checks. This is the best way to prevent the development of asbestos-related diseases or to identify any early warning signs.

Certain people are more at risk for asbestos exposure than others. For example, Navy veterans may have been exposed to the material when working on ships or in other military facilities. In addition, those working in shipyard repair, heating system repair construction, and the automotive industry have also been known to be exposed to asbestos.

There are many different agencies that create rules and regulations for employers to comply with when it comes to asbestos in the workplace. If you believe that your employer isn't complying with the standards, contact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) for more information or a workplace inspection.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health and employment records in order to create a timeline for your asbestos exposure. Then, they will construct your case by assembling evidence that proves that you were exposed and that exposure caused harm. They will send every defendant a copy of your complaint and will give them 30 days to respond. Defendants will often deny their responsibility and will often attempt to blame someone else. You need an experienced team of attorneys to deal with these denials.

Once they have all the necessary documents Your attorney will start the asbestos lawsuit. They will file it in the state court system that best suits your situation. During this period, the att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ery, where they share information with the opposing side about the case. If a trial is requested and they are required to represent you in the trial. However, the majority of cases are resolved through an asbestos compensation Settlement, Linkic.Co.Kr,.

It is crucial to hire a mesothelioma expert because as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ury claims. They have access a database which shows the patients the asbestos products they used on the job. This makes it easier for patients to determine the asbestos products that were at fault for their exposure.

In addition, they will know what types of companies are responsible for your exposure, including the companies that manufacture the asbestos-containing products you handled and even the property ow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
